Since May 5th, David and I have both been juicing organic veggies and citrus and such. We have only missed maybe 4 days when we are busy running around, but on those days, we did healthy breakfast smoothies or we ate salads along with our other meals. We dont ONLY juice, we do eat other things we like. We dont buy sugar anymore. We only use Stevia or Truvia. We have cut WAY back on bread. We rarely buy potato chips. We dont use catsup, we use Louisiana Hot Sauce on everything. David was walking 4 miles a day but he hurt his back then his foot started bothering him, so he is taking a break. A week ago I bought a mini trampoline (rebounder) and I have been using it every day. Its harder than it looks to stay on it for more than 7 minutes at a time. I am building up stamina everyday. The energy levels we have are Way UP there! David can do the rebounder too EVEN with replacement knees. Its way easier on the joints than walking on the ground. And the best thing lately we have noticed we Sleep all night really good and dont wake up at 4 or 5 a.m. Organic is the way to go whenever possible, to avoid pesticides. Farmers Markets and little Farm stands are the Best! We make breakfast everyday if possible. We incorporate peppers/green chilies/pablanos..any kind of green or other color peppers...DAILY. We make Migas a lot with fresh corn tortillas and chilies. Yum. We have not given up bacon, and not gonna! WE ration our daily bacon to two slices, so we dont go overboard. We rarely eat potatoes, but when we can find them we buy Purple potatoes. We cook Quinoa a Lot, its our new Rice, and I think I could be vegetarian easily, but we are not quite that strict yet. We have been experimenting with gluten free products, so far we dont like much of them. We just try to eat lots of foods that are naturally gluten free. WE feel so good and Healthy and Lean!
